$SU(2)^2$-invariant $G_2$-instantons

Differential Geometry 2018-04-24 v3

Abstract

We initiate the systematic study of G2G_2-instantons with SU(2)2SU(2)^2-symmetry. As well as developing foundational theory, we give existence, non-existence and classification results for these instantons. We particularly focus on R4×S3\mathbb{R}^4\times S^3 with its two explicitly known distinct holonomy G2G_2 metrics, which have different volume growths at infinity, exhibiting the different behaviour of instantons in these settings. We also give an explicit example of sequences of G2G_2-instantons where "bubbling" and "removable singularity" phenomena occur in the limit.
